ESPN is saying that Erin Andrews, whose ESPN contract expires Saturday, is leaving ESPN.
Andrews, says Fox, is departing ESPN for Fox Sports’ college football coverage.
Fox was tight-lipped Friday night. The sports devision of the network is making a big push into college football coverage this season. The Fox broadcast network this year begins its first regular-season college football coverage.
ESPN, in a statement, said Andrews “did great work for us and we made an aggressive offer to keep her.”
